aboutsummaryrefslogtreecommitdiff
path: root/gui
diff options
context:
space:
mode:
authorVicent Marti2008-05-28 14:30:51 +0000
committerVicent Marti2008-05-28 14:30:51 +0000
commit426c36992dd23647b7316de9ba2aeb12a4d8d94c (patch)
tree2340659d84e1b0605dca4f909e2da71aea3b1983 /gui
parent119b7126b9162eb0adefaff7a2f002f23472824b (diff)
downloadscummvm-rg350-426c36992dd23647b7316de9ba2aeb12a4d8d94c.tar.gz
scummvm-rg350-426c36992dd23647b7316de9ba2aeb12a4d8d94c.tar.bz2
scummvm-rg350-426c36992dd23647b7316de9ba2aeb12a4d8d94c.zip
Bugfixes: Discarded function, switch fix.
svn-id: r32340
Diffstat (limited to 'gui')
-rw-r--r--gui/InterfaceManager.cpp3
-rw-r--r--gui/InterfaceManager.h9
2 files changed, 4 insertions, 8 deletions
diff --git a/gui/InterfaceManager.cpp b/gui/InterfaceManager.cpp
index 8469654657..6aa5bac733 100644
--- a/gui/InterfaceManager.cpp
+++ b/gui/InterfaceManager.cpp
@@ -59,6 +59,9 @@ void InterfaceManager::setGraphicsMode(Graphics_Mode mode) {
_bytesPerPixel = sizeof(uint16);
screenInit<uint16>();
break;
+
+ default:
+ return;
}
_vectorRenderer = Graphics::createRenderer(mode);
diff --git a/gui/InterfaceManager.h b/gui/InterfaceManager.h
index 5a5eccff41..4e98fbc692 100644
--- a/gui/InterfaceManager.h
+++ b/gui/InterfaceManager.h
@@ -58,14 +58,7 @@ public:
int runGUI();
protected:
- Graphics::VectorRenderer *createRenderer() {
- // TODO: Find out what pixel format we are using,
- // create the renderer accordingly
- return new Graphics::VectorRendererSpec<uint16, ColorMasks<565> >;
- }
-
- template<typename PixelType>
- void screenInit();
+ template<typename PixelType> void screenInit();
void freeRenderer() {
if (_vectorRenderer != NULL)